Farsi/Persian-language ciphered transmission — known as Numbers Station "V32" — was received loud and clear in Northern Italy at 18:23 UTC on March 11, 2026, on frequency 7842 kHz.
Numbers stations are shortwave radio transmissions used by intelligence agencies to send coded messages to operatives in foreign countries. V32 has been active throughout the conflict, frequently changing frequencies in response to jamming attempts. Clear reception indicates active intelligence communications despite countermeasures.

Farsi/Persian-language Numbers Station active now on 7842 kHz. As expected, due to heavy jamming on 7910 kHz, the station changed frequency. Received in Milan at 18:14 UTC on March 7, 2026.
For context: Numbers stations are shortwave radio transmissions used by intelligence agencies to send coded messages to operatives in foreign countries. A frequency change under jamming indicates active countermeasures and adaptation — meaning these are live intelligence communications.
